Red Sea’s highly-anticipated ReefDose redefines ease-of-use and smart functionality for aquarium dosing pumps, offering advanced programming and incredible dosing accuracy for the most demanding applications. The ReefDose was built from the ground up to meet the needs of modern reef aquarists. Utilizing Red Sea’s custom-built dosing heads, the ReefDose is capable of delivering incredible single-drop precision through a variety of dosing programs. The three dosing speed settings offer additional versatility, prioritizing whisper quiet operating at up to 15mL per minute, all the way up to 45mL per minute with Turbo mode.
Features
Single drop accuracy dosing heads with a direct-drive planetary gear-motor, provides an accuracy of ± 0.05ml or an average deviation of 0.5% (over 10ml).
4 easy-set, smart dosing options for each head, that are automatically combined into one coordinated schedule.
Easy assembly click-on/off dosing heads (no tools or alignment required).
Automatic delay between the heads to prevent chemical interaction between supplements.
Automatic dose compensation for doses missing due to power loss.
Daily dose per head of 0.2ml up to 1000ml in increments of 0.1ml.
On-demand manual dosing.
3 dosing flow rates: Whisper 15ml/min, Regular 30ml/min, Turbo 45 ml/min.
Motor life expectancy of 10 years – based on 250ml/day/head.
The ReefDose is more than just another programmable dosing pump. Smart software functionality like the “Dynamic Dosing Queue” run by the controller combines the desired dosing plans for each head into one coordinated daily dosing schedule for the complete device. The queue is automatically updated after any settings changes, and reschedules any doses that are missed due to unscheduled events such as power outages, maintenance, or feeding.

Coral Color A is a complex of halogens (Iodine, Bromine and Fluorine). The halogens act both as antioxidants and oxidative agents within the soft tissue and mucus layer of corals, reducing the possibility of coral bleaching. In active reef systems, these elements are depleted quickly due to their high oxidative abilities and reactivity with organic materials. Iodine and bromine are related to the pinkchroma-protein (pocciloporin).Coral Color B is a complex of Potassium and Boron. Potassium plays an essential role in the transportation of coral nutrients within the soft tissue (including the nutrients provided by the Zooxanthellae). Potassium and Boron significantly affect the alkalinity of a coral’s soft tissue and the formation of aragonite in its skeleton. Potassium is related to the red chroma-proteins.Coral Color C is a complex of 8 “light” metals that includes Iron, Manganese, Cobalt, Copper, Aluminum, Zinc, Chrome and Nickel. These micro-elements are essential to many bio-chemical metabolic processes, including respiration, production of energy, chlorophyll and photosynthetic catalysts. C elements are related to the green/yellow chroma-proteins.Coral Color D is a complex of 18 trace elements. These 18 elements (out of all the trace elements in NSW) participate in the metabolic processes inside a coral’s skeleton and soft tissue. D elements are related to the blue/purple chroma-proteins.Weekly dosing - Soft CoralsTest the Color Elements every week and dose each supplement to replenish back to the optimal levels.Daily dosing - SPS coralsEnsure that all of the Color Elements are at optimal values and run the aquarium for4 days at a stable salinity (compensate for evaporation daily) without adding anysupplements. At the end of the 4 days test the Color Elements and calculate the “4 day dosage” of each supplement to replenish back to the optimal levels. Add the “4 day dosage” to the system. Divide this “4 day dosage” by 4 and use as the daily dosage for the next week.After a week of adding the daily dosage, test the Color Elements and calculate the adjusting dosage of each supplement to replenish back to the optimal levels.
If the adjusting dosage is significantly different from the previous daily dosage amend (increase/decrease) the daily dosage as appropriate.
If the measured level of a specific element is above the optimal level wait for the excess of the element to be depleted before restarting the daily supplementation with the amended daily dosage.
Continue testing all of the elements every week and make adjustments to the dailydosages as required. As your corals grow or you add or remove livestock the uptake of the elements in your aquarium will gradually change. It is recommended to keep a log book of the weekly measurements and dosages.If you miss one or more days of supplementing add the complete amount that you have missed but do not exceed the maximum recommended daily increase for any of the elements

Introduction to pH & Alkalinity:
The pH is a very important parameter in the biology of aquatic organisms. It is a measure of the acidity or basicity of the water. The scale runs from zero to 14. Zero is the most acidic, 7 is neutral and 14 is the most basic. A change of 1 pH unit, for example from 7 to 6, means that the water gets 10 times more acidic.Due to its chemistry, salt-water is able to absorb a certain amount of acidic matter without a resulting change in pH. The substances in the water that do this are called buffers. The ability of water to withstand changes in pH is called buffer capacity. Based on a method of measuring buffer capacity it is referred to as the alkalinity of seawater. In some of the literature alkalinity is termed “Carbonate Hardness” or “ KH Carbonate Buffer”. This is exactly the same measurement as is measured in the Alkalinity Mini-Lab Test.pH and Alkalinity
The pH of natural seawater varies geographically in the world’s oceans between 8.1 and 8.4. On a local scale the pH is however remarkably stable. This is due to dissolved buffers (mainly bicarbonates), which prevent pH changes. Because of the enormous volume of the ocean, a nearly inexhaustible stock of buffers are present: the sea can take up large amounts of acids, without a noticeable change in pH.Compared to the sea the volume of a marine aquarium is very limited and therefore the alkalinity is also limited. As fish produce acid waste products and as the buffering substances are used up by calcareous algae and invertebrates, the buffer capacity may become so low that the pH could suddenly fall. This would be very dangerous to all organisms in the aquarium.The alkalinity is measured in so called mil-equivalents of alkaline substances (for example sodium bicarbonate) per liter. These alkaline substances have the power to prevent pH drops. The alkalinity of natural seawater is approximately 2.5 mil-equivalents per liter. This level should also be maintained in the marine aquarium.A common symptom of an unsuitable pH is pH-stress. Especially in the marine aquarium, unsuitable pH values are very stressful to fish, and increase the chance of the fish being susceptible to disease (marine white spot).

Customizable DIY Aquarium Net Cover
Keep your finny friends safe inside your tank with a customizable Red Sea Aquarium Net Cover.
With a sleek profile and minimalist hangers the Red Sea Net Cover blends in seamlessly even on ultra-clear, rimless, open-top aquariums.
The extra strong aluminum frame and purpose designed components allow the extra thin transparent net cover to be customized to accommodate rim-mounted equipment such as lighting arms, auto-feeders and overflow boxes.
Check out our how-to video that shows exactly how to assemble Red Sea’s fish saver, step-by-step. Keep in mind that this is a Do-it-Yourself cover, and while it offers versatility and customizability at a fraction of the cost of custom-built covers, it does require proper DIY skills including planning, taking exact measurements and cutting aluminum profiles. So if you aren’t a DIY project kind of hobbyist, you can always ask your local dealer or a handy friend to help.
Designed specifically for rimless tanks the Red Sea cover also works well with braced tanks such as the MAX® S-series.

Fully featured 75 litre/20 gal, Plug & Play® reef system
The MAX® NANO combines a contemporary, rimless design with state of the art technology.
This fully-featured REEF-SPEC® system provides everything necessary in order to enable you to enjoy the beauty and diversity of your own piece of thriving coral reef, rather than worrying about component selection, suitability and compatibility.
The all new MAX® NANO features the very latest in reef-keeping technology including AI’s Prime HD LED lighting with integrated Wi-Fi control, REEF-SPEC® filtration and circulation systems, an Automatic Top-Off unit and an easy access power center.
Selecting a Red Sea MAX® NANO makes reef-keeping easier than ever before.
Red Sea MAX® True REEF-SPEC® for a successful reef
The Red Sea MAX REEF-SPEC® performance criteria is the result of Red Sea’s years of research into the sustainable growth of all corals, including the most delicate “SPS” corals, in an artificial reef environment. This knowledge, gained over 25 years, forms the basis for the specification of all Red Sea MAX® Aquarium systems designs.
Advanced LED Lighting system with integrated Wi-Fi
The MAX® NANO incorporate the all-new AI Prime HD LED lighting, providing the most up to date LED technology to give superb performance and a remarkably user-friendly interface.
The Prime HD unit offers a full spectrum, 7 color LED configuration giving great color rendition and a multitude of lighting effects.
MAX® NANO ultra-clear glass
The front and two side panels of the MAX® NANO are constructed from 8mm ultra-clear glass with smart beveled edges top and bottom for the ultimate viewing experience.
MAX® NANO Circulation
A European Eco pump provides 950 l/h(240gph) of water flow, circulating the entire water volume 12 times an hour through the filter system. Flow is returned to the aquarium via the discrete multidirectional “eye ball” nozzles that can be adjusted to ensure there are no dead spots within the aquarium, preventing harmful detritus from building up on the corals.
MAX® NANO Rear Sump
The complete filtration system is hidden in the rear sump that is topped by a rotatable screen for easy access. Fed by a unique surface skimmer that directs the water to a bespoke micron filter bag, the rear sump houses a silenced REEF-SPEC® protein skimmer, a 950lph/240gph European ECO circulation pump and 100g of REEF-SPEC® Carbon to keep the water crystal clear.
The MAX® NANO is supplied with a 225 micron bag. 100 micron, fine polishing filter bags are also available.
MAX® NANO Protein Skimmer
The heart of the filtration system is the protein skimmer. The NANO skimmer implements Red Sea’s REEF-SPEC® criteria for SPS corals, passing the entire volume of the aquarium water through the skimmer approximately 3 times per hour and with a 3 to 1 water to air ratio. The NANO skimmer is not affected by the regular fluctuation in the water level of the rear sump due to evaporation and has an adjustable outlet gate to maintain the optimal skimmate consistency which will vary according to actual water conditions. The NANO skimmer runs quietly with a built-in silencer on the air intake and a sponge on the outlet to eliminate the sound of cascading water.
MAX® NANO Media Shelf
The rear sump includes a fixed shelf for media, positioned to guarantee 100% positive water flow. The MAX® NANO is supplied with 100g of Red Sea’s REEF-SPEC® carbon that will keep the aquarium water crystal clear for the first 2 months of operation.
Automatic Top-Off
The MAX® NANO includes an Automatic Top-Off unit with a 1.5 litre/ 3.1 gal freshwater reservoir that is hidden behind the screen above the sump.
The design of the rear sump together with the automatic top-off reservoir makes the MAX® NANO self-sufficient for about 3 days.
Control Unit for skimmer and circulation pumps
The MAX® NANO features a power center with individual on/off switches for the skimmer and circulation pumps enabling easy access for feeding and maintenance.
Rotatable Rear Sump Screen.
A screen above the rear sump keeps all of the equipment out of sight but conveniently rotates out of the way for all regular maintenance and if necessary can be completely removed.
MARINE-SPEC Cabinet
The MAX® NANO is available with an optional marine-spec laminate cabinet fronted with weatherproof epoxy painted doors with convenient push openers as well as soft close stainless steel hinges. The MAX® NANO cabinets are offered with Black or White exteriors.

Rimless reef-ready systems for advanced hobbyistsREEFER™ Peninsula
If you’re looking to add the distinctive beauty of a Peninsula-style coral reef aquarium to your home or office, you don’t need a custom-built system to do so. Red Sea’s new REEFER™ Peninsula brings color and ambiance to any living or office space at a fraction of the cost of a custom installation.
Available in 125cm (49.2″) long/ 500 liter (132 gal) or 160cm (63″) long/650 liter (173 gal), the REEFER™ Peninsula offers an impressive and elegant room divider solution with all of the features of our advanced REEFER™ systems. A rimless, ultra-clear glass coral reef aquarium is formed into a perfect peninsula that gives you a fascinating view from all three sides, adding complexity and intrigue to any reefscape.
These 60cm (23.6″) high aquariums are set on stylish yet heavy duty cabinets with epoxy painted finish on both sides. The cabinet includes a dedicated ventilated compartment for chiller and control systems and the doors may be assembled on either side of the cabinet to suit the layout of the room.
The REEFER™ Peninsula is also available in a Deluxe configuration incorporating the Hydra 26 HD LED lights with Red Sea’s customized hanging system.
The unique design of the Peninsula with the overflow system at one end of the aquarium instead of at the center also makes it ideal for a room corner installation.
REEFER™ ConceptRed Sea’s REEFER™ series of Reef Systems provide advanced hobbyists with a solid foundation for building a fully featured reef or marine aquarium.
The REEFER™ series combines a contemporary, rimless, ultra-clear glass aquarium with a stylish cabinet and a comprehensive water management system including a professional sump with integrated automatic top-up and Red Sea’s unique silent down-flow system.
Incorporating technologies originally developed for Red Sea’s all-in-one MAX® coral reef systems, the REEFER™ series is designed for ease of operation while enabling the advanced hobbyist to install an unlimited choice of lighting, filtration, circulation and controllers to create a uniquely customized system.REEFER™ Peninsula SumpThe REEFER Peninsula series have advanced sumps with the following exciting new features::
An adjustable height skimmer chamber, enabling you to set the water level (between 21-27cm / 8.3″-10.6″) for optimal skimmer performance.
A “Refugium Ready” sump with two pre-set positions allows you to decide how much of the sump you want for your skimmer and other reactors and how much as a dedicated refugium chamber.
4 micron filter bagsRO liter reservoir that can be slid aside when necessary for pump maintenance.Red Sea REEFER™ Peninsula DeluxeThe REEFER™ Peninsula Deluxe incorporates the all-new Hydra 26™ HD LED lighting units with Red Sea’s customized hanging system into the Reefer reef ready systems in a convenient single package.
The Hydra 26™ HD unit provides the most up to date LED technology, offering a full spectrum, 7 color LED configuration giving great color rendition and a multitude of lighting effects. The revolutionary control system dynamically adjusts the power available to each color by utilizing power not being used with other colors, effectively enabling selected channels to be ‘boosted’ to above 100% output. The lighting is fully controllable via the built-in WiFi which is compatible with iOS and Android devices, and with any wifi-enabled Mac or PC. REEFER™ Peninsula Deluxe is available for both the 500 & 650 models with 3 and 4 LED units respectively.

The all-new REEFER G2 series of Reef-Ready aquarium systems has improved upon the REEF-SPEC infrastructure of the original Red Sea REEFER series. With a new and revamped water management system, extra-fortified plywood cabinets, thicker and rimless glass, refugium-ready & ReefMat-compatible sumps, and extended warranty plans; the G2 REEFER aquarium series is designed to be the perfect canvas for the customized reef tank of your dreams!
New & Improved Features
Rimless ultra-clear, beveled-edge glass with increased thickness
Extra-fortified plywood marine-spec laminated cabinets (with additional aluminum “floating tank” supports on REEFER 625 G2 models and bigger)
Dual side-facing return pump outlets for better water distribution (On REEFER 350 G2 models and bigger)
Large central overflow box to hide piping, with a large surface skimmer with removable weir comb for easy cleaning
Silent downflow system with enlarged rectangular inlet to reduce turbulence
Assembly-ready piping now with extra bulkhead connectors in both Metric and USA sizes for customized setups
New and improved high-precision valve on the downflow pipe for easier flow regulation and near-silent operation
Professional REEF-SPEC sump, including:
Mechanical filtration media compartment complete with micron filters and filter cups
Optional refugium compartment
Adjustable height skimmer chamber
Bubble trap
RO Reservoir
Plug & play ready for ReefMat 500 or 1200 Auto Filter Roller (sold separately)
Additional chamber for chillers, controllers, or other equipment (on most models)
Extra-fortified Glass and Marine-Spec Cabinets
The G2 series of REEFER aquariums are rimless and constructed from ultra-clear, beveled-edge glass with an increased glass thickness of up to 19mm. These strong glass tanks sit atop newly fortified cabinet stands made of plywood and with Marine-Spec, water-resistant lamination. Each cabinet stand follows the contours of the aquarium glass, with the larger REEFER G2 models featuring an additional “floating tank” aluminum support. Adjustable leveling feet & stainless steel hinges ensure a lasting and durable stand for your dream aquarium.
Improved Water Management & Plumbing
Up top, the G2 REEFER systems employ a large overflow box with dual side-facing return pumps for optimal water circulation and increased surface skimming. The overflow box includes a lid which hides plumbing components, as well as easily-removable weir combs for quick cleaning and improved surface skimming. Water then exits from the overflow box and travels down an enlarged and rectangular inlet to the downflow pipe, allowing for reduced turbulence & quieter operation. All G2 models also include a newly improved high precision valve on the downflow pipe, allowing for simple regulation to further tune your flow.
Reef-Ready Sump– Now ReefMat Compatible
As with the previous generation of REEFER, the G2 sump includes a mechanical filtration compartment complete with micron filter sock(s) and filter cup(s) to keep large pieces of debris and detritus from clogging pumps and other pieces of equipment. New to the G2, this chamber can be alternatively used with a ReefMat 500 or 1200-- no modifications required! Water flows from the filtration chamber into the adjustable-height skimmer compartment, where the water will be kept at a steady level to aid in the best performance for your choice of skimmer, or any other filtration components that you choose to include. The water will then flow through the final bubble trap and into a chamber where the return pump (not included) can be placed to pump water back through the Reefer tank's return plumbing.
Addtional features of the Reef-Ready sump system include an optional refugium compartment for growing chaeto or other macroalgae, as well as an RO reservoir that can hold a few days worth of top off water to keep the water level, salinity and flow rates consistent throughout the tank.
